Pros:
- The menu selection offers a pretty good variety of middle-eastern dishes. From lamb to chicken to beef, there's a number of different ways to order it.
- I settled on the chicken shawarma platter, which was pretty solid. It wasn't the best shawarma I've ever had, but it was well executed overall. The best part of the dish was honestly the rice on the side - I could have eaten a plate full of that easily!
- The food was out in about 7 minutes - fresh and very good.
Cons:
- As a solo diner, I was disappointed there weren't any sides/apps that were either sized or priced for one person. I didn't even see a side of pita on the menu or anything as simple as that.
- There were two servers during my time there, but they seemed to distracted with each other to pay much attention to me. I got my food before I got my iced tea that I ordered at the same time. I was probably halfway though my dinner before the server noticed he had forgotten it. After that point, he offered refills a plenty to help make up for his mistake, for what it's worth. However, I was left wondering what was up again when I had to tell the server multiple times that I was ready for my check after I was done eating. It was almost bizarre.
- Seating was a little awkward. There was no discernible "seat yourself sign", but there was also nobody at the front of the house to greet or guide me. It's a pretty small shop, so I wasn't left wondering, but I sat at a clean table kind of awkwardly wondering if I was doing the right thing or not. I'm still not even sure if that was correct or not.
Would I go again? Probably not. Not because the place was awful, but because I'm equally interested in other restaurants in the area and would like to try those more than I want to re-visit Cedars.
